  • Expandable polylactic acid resin particles
    申请人:JSP CORPORATION
    公开号:EP1683828A2
    公开(公告)日:2006-07-26
    Expandable polylactic acid resin particles including (a) a base resin containing a polylactic acid resin having at least 50 mol % of lactic acid monomer component units, (b) a polyolefin wax in an amount of 0.0001 to 1 part by weight per 100 parts by weight of the base resin, and (c) a blowing agent in an amount of 1 to 30 % by weight based on the weight of the resin particles. The expandable resin particles can give expanded beads having an average cell diameter of 10 to 500 µm. The expanded beads can give in-mold foam moldings.
    可膨胀聚乳酸树脂颗粒包括:(a) 含有聚乳酸树脂的基础树脂,该树脂至少含有 50 摩尔%的乳酸单体成分单位;(b) 聚烯烃蜡,其用量为每 100 份基础树脂 0.0001 至 1 份(按重量计);(c) 发泡剂,其用量为树脂颗粒重量的 1%至 30%(按重量计)。可膨胀树脂颗粒可产生平均细胞直径为 10 至 500 微米的膨胀珠。膨胀珠可制成模内泡沫塑料。
  • Polylactic acid adhesive compositions and methods for their preparation and use
    申请人:PURDUE RESEARCH FOUNDATION
    公开号:US10442966B2
    公开(公告)日:2019-10-15
    New adhesives and methods for preparing them are disclosed that include polylactic acid irradiated with gamma radiation, such as by a Co60 source. Irradiation times are used that improve the characteristics of the adhesive materials. Generally, the dose of radiation is from about 5 kGy to about 200 kGy of gamma irradiation. The adhesives generally have melting temperatures in the range of at least about 140 to about 148° C. such that they can be conveniently used in conventional glue guns and other glue equipment. The disclosed adhesives can provide bond strengths in the range of about 1,600 psi or more to about 2,500 psi or more. The disclosed adhesives can include a crosslinking agents. They can be used to join a wide range of substrates including wood, metal, plastic, ceramic, glass or combinations of substrates. They can be conveniently prepared by heating a polylactic acid (polylactic acid) preparation and mixing the molten polylactic acid with one or more crosslinkers when present. The molten mixture can then be and the polylactic acid can be irradiated with the desired dose of gamma radiation. Irradiation can occur before during or after mixing with the crosslinking agent and before or after shaping into the desired shape or even after use to join substrates. The adhesives can be used to join substrates by any known method once heated to a molten state.
    本文公开了新型粘合剂及其制备方法,其中包括用伽马射线(如 Co60 源)辐照的聚乳酸。辐照时间可改善粘合剂材料的特性。一般来说,伽马辐照的剂量在 5 kGy 到 200 kGy 之间。粘合剂的熔化温度一般至少在约 140 至约 148 摄氏度之间,因此可方便地用于传统的胶枪和其他胶设备。所公开的粘合剂可提供约 1,600 psi 或更高至约 2,500 psi 或更高的粘合强度。所公开的粘合剂可包括交联剂。它们可用于连接各种基材,包括木材、属、塑料、陶瓷、玻璃或基材组合。可通过加热聚乳酸制剂并将熔融聚乳酸与一种或多种交联剂(如有)混合,方便地制备粘合剂。然后用所需剂量的伽马射线辐照熔融混合物和聚乳酸。辐照可发生在与交联剂混合之前或之后,以及成型为所需形状之前或之后,甚至在用于连接基材之后。粘合剂加热至熔融状态后,可采用任何已知方法连接基材。
